Output 0678950d80853bd729aa72193054d1c74e5d00bcf187690b289d421af95b7a26:18

value
29054
script pubkey
OP_0 OP_PUSHBYTES_20 f1c40e40aa63b39596b1e9a8ebb15e0e663ed8a3
address
bc1q78zqus92vweet943ax5whv27penrak9rec6wgx
transaction
0678950d80853bd729aa72193054d1c74e5d00bcf187690b289d421af95b7a26
spent
true